Photography in Mexico:
Art and Politics focuses on photography from the post-Mexican Revolution to the present. The talk highlights the rich and powerful photographic tradition in Mexico and features the mastery of a variety of styles. The presentation explores the work of Mexican photographers as well as international photographers and looks at the range of approaches and concerns that photographers in Mexico have pursued over time. A lecturer from the San Francisco Museum of Modern Art will give the talk.
